Discriminant Validity
A measure of the degree to which a construct is truly distinct from other constructs by correlating minimally or not at all with measures from which it is theoretically supposed to differ.
IQ
An abbreviation for Intelligence Quotient, it's a measure of a person's reasoning ability compared to the statistical norm or average for their age, taken as 100.
Mode
A statistical term that refers to the most frequently occurring number found in a set of numbers.
Barnum Effect
The phenomenon where individuals believe that vague, general personality descriptions accurately apply specifically to them.
